this song is about rape... its ever so apparent. i remember hearing, back a few years ago, that nada surf's singer's girlfriend had been raped and that is responsible for a change in their music on proximity effect, naturally. that would make sense here... this is obviously a strong, angry, personal song. i can't imagine anyone capturing such aimed anger without having somet type of firsthand experience with rape. if you guys know anything more about this, please post...id really like to find out whats up here.
a friend of mine interviewed matthew from nada surf last year and he said that this song is pretty much a public service announcement. he said that he wrote this song with the idea of "if he had 4 minutes to say something important, this is what he would say". i think he did a pretty good job. as far as the personal nature of this song, i dont know for sure, but i'm sure there is some foundation there because robot also touches on this subject.
